Growth Experiments & A/B Testing: A Practical Guide

Practical Guides on Implementing Growth Experiments and A/B Testing for Marketing

Are you ready to unlock rapid growth for your business? The key lies in data-driven decision-making through structured experimentation. This article provides practical guides on implementing growth experiments and A/B testing, specifically tailored for marketing professionals. But how do you ensure your tests are valid and actually lead to meaningful results?

1. Defining Your Growth Hypothesis and Metrics

Before diving into A/B testing, it’s crucial to establish a clear growth hypothesis. This is a testable statement predicting the outcome of a specific change. For example, “Changing the headline on our landing page will increase conversion rates by 15%.”

Here’s how to craft a strong hypothesis:

  1. Identify a Problem: What aspect of your marketing funnel needs improvement? Is it low website traffic, poor conversion rates, or high customer churn? Analyze your Google Analytics data to pinpoint areas for optimization.
  2. Formulate a Hypothesis: Based on your analysis, create a specific, measurable, achievable, relevant, and time-bound (SMART) hypothesis.
  3. Define Key Metrics: Determine the metrics that will validate or invalidate your hypothesis. These could include conversion rate, click-through rate (CTR), bounce rate, time on page, or revenue per user.

A study by HubSpot in 2025 found that companies with documented marketing strategies are 313% more likely to report success.

Selecting the right metrics is crucial. Avoid vanity metrics that look good but don’t impact your bottom line. Focus on metrics that directly correlate with your business goals. For instance, if your goal is to increase sales, track revenue per user and conversion rates rather than just website traffic.

2. Setting Up Your A/B Testing Infrastructure

Implementing A/B testing requires the right tools and infrastructure. Several platforms can help you design, run, and analyze your experiments:

  • Optimizely: A comprehensive platform for website and mobile app experimentation.
  • VWO (Visual Website Optimizer): Offers A/B testing, multivariate testing, and personalization features.
  • Google Optimize: A free tool integrated with Google Analytics, suitable for basic A/B testing.
  • HubSpot: If you use HubSpot for marketing automation, its A/B testing functionality is integrated directly into your workflows.

Regardless of the platform you choose, ensure it supports:

  • Randomization: Randomly assigning users to different variations to eliminate bias.
  • Statistical Significance: Calculating the probability that the results are not due to chance.
  • Segmentation: Targeting specific user groups for more relevant experiments.
  • Integration: Seamlessly integrating with your analytics platform for data tracking.

Before launching your first test, conduct thorough quality assurance (QA) to ensure all variations function correctly across different browsers and devices. A broken experiment yields invalid data.

3. Designing Effective A/B Tests

The design of your A/B tests is paramount. Here are some key considerations:

  • Test One Element at a Time: To isolate the impact of a specific change, test only one element per experiment. Testing multiple elements simultaneously makes it difficult to determine which change caused the observed effect.
  • Prioritize High-Impact Changes: Focus on elements that have the potential to significantly impact your key metrics. These might include headlines, calls to action, images, or form layouts.
  • Create Clear and Compelling Variations: Ensure your variations are distinct and offer a clear alternative to the control. Avoid subtle changes that are unlikely to produce noticeable results.
  • Consider Sample Size: Determine the required sample size to achieve statistical significance. Use a sample size calculator to estimate the number of users needed for each variation. Insufficient sample sizes lead to inconclusive results.

For example, if you’re testing a new call-to-action button, make sure the new button’s text, color, and placement are noticeably different from the original. A slight shade change in color is unlikely to drive a significant change in conversion rates.

4. Running and Monitoring Your Experiments

Once your A/B test is live, it’s crucial to monitor its performance closely. Keep an eye on your key metrics and track the progress of each variation.

Here’s a step-by-step guide:

  1. Monitor Performance Daily: Check your testing platform and analytics dashboard daily to identify any issues or anomalies.
  2. Track Statistical Significance: Use your testing platform to determine when your results reach statistical significance. This indicates that the observed difference between variations is unlikely due to chance. Most platforms will show a confidence interval (typically 95% or higher).
  3. Avoid Premature Conclusions: Resist the temptation to end the test prematurely. Allow it to run for a sufficient duration to account for weekly and monthly fluctuations in user behavior.
  4. Segment Your Data: Analyze your results by segmenting your data based on user demographics, device type, or traffic source. This can reveal valuable insights about which variations resonate with specific user groups.

It’s generally recommended to run A/B tests for at least one to two weeks to capture a representative sample of user behavior. However, the exact duration will depend on your traffic volume and the magnitude of the observed effect.

5. Analyzing Results and Iterating

After your A/B test concludes, it’s time to analyze the results and draw conclusions.

Follow these steps:

  1. Determine the Winner: Identify the variation that performed best based on your key metrics and statistical significance.
  2. Document Your Findings: Record the results of your experiment, including the hypothesis, variations tested, key metrics, and conclusions. This documentation will serve as a valuable resource for future experiments.
  3. Implement the Winning Variation: Implement the winning variation on your website or app.
  4. Iterate and Test Again: Use the insights gained from your experiment to generate new hypotheses and design new A/B tests. Continuous iteration is key to driving sustained growth.

For instance, if your A/B test revealed that a new headline increased conversion rates by 20%, implement the new headline and then test different variations of the call-to-action button to further optimize the landing page.

6. Advanced Growth Experimentation Techniques

Beyond basic A/B testing, several advanced techniques can help you unlock even greater growth:

  • Multivariate Testing: Test multiple elements simultaneously to identify the optimal combination of changes. This is useful for optimizing complex pages with numerous variables.
  • Personalization: Tailor the user experience based on individual user characteristics, such as demographics, behavior, or purchase history.
  • Behavioral Targeting: Target users based on their behavior on your website or app. For example, you could show a special offer to users who have abandoned their shopping cart.
  • Funnel Analysis: Analyze the steps users take to complete a specific goal, such as making a purchase or signing up for a newsletter. Identify bottlenecks in the funnel and run experiments to optimize each step.

These techniques require a more sophisticated understanding of data analysis and user behavior. However, they can yield significant results when implemented effectively.

In conclusion, mastering growth experiments and A/B testing is essential for modern marketing. By following these practical guides, you can transform your marketing efforts from guesswork to data-driven decision-making. What specific A/B test will you implement first to improve your marketing performance?

What is the difference between A/B testing and multivariate testing?

A/B testing compares two versions of a single variable, while multivariate testing tests multiple variables and their combinations simultaneously. Multivariate testing is more complex but can reveal more nuanced insights.

How long should I run an A/B test?

The duration of an A/B test depends on your traffic volume and the magnitude of the observed effect. Generally, it’s recommended to run the test for at least one to two weeks to capture a representative sample of user behavior. Ensure you reach statistical significance before concluding the test.

What sample size do I need for A/B testing?

The required sample size depends on your baseline conversion rate, the expected improvement, and the desired statistical power. Use a sample size calculator to estimate the number of users needed for each variation. Insufficient sample sizes lead to inconclusive results.

What are some common A/B testing mistakes to avoid?

Common mistakes include testing too many elements at once, not running the test long enough, not achieving statistical significance, ignoring data segmentation, and not documenting your findings.

How can I ensure my A/B tests are valid?

To ensure validity, use a reliable A/B testing platform, randomize users, control for external factors, monitor performance closely, and analyze results rigorously. Conduct thorough quality assurance (QA) to ensure all variations function correctly across different browsers and devices.

In summary, this article outlined practical guides on implementing growth experiments and A/B testing. You learned how to define hypotheses, set up your testing infrastructure, design effective tests, monitor performance, and analyze results. The key takeaway? Start small, iterate often, and let data be your guide. Begin with a simple A/B test on your website’s headline today and track the results!

Sienna Blackwell

John Smith is a seasoned marketing consultant specializing in actionable tips for boosting brand visibility and customer engagement. He's spent over a decade distilling complex marketing strategies into simple, effective advice.